Asbestos Assessment in Old Bridge, NJ
Asbestos assessment services involve inspecting residential properties to identify the presence of asbestos-containing materials. These assessments are commonly requested during renovation, remodeling, or demolition projects, as well as when purchasing a home or conducting routine inspections. The process typically includes a thorough visual inspection and may involve collecting samples for laboratory analysis to determine if asbestos is present and to assess its condition. Property owners often seek this service to understand potential health risks and to ensure proper handling or removal of asbestos before any construction work begins.
Homeowners usually want to know whether asbestos materials are present in areas such as insulation, flooring, roofing, or walls, and whether those materials are in a condition that could release fibers into the air. Understanding the extent and location of asbestos allows property owners to make informed decisions about necessary repairs, removals, or further testing. Clarifying these details beforehand helps ensure that any work performed is safe and compliant with local regulations, providing peace of mind during renovation or property transactions.

Common Asbestos Assessment Jobs
Asbestos Inspection - Identifies the presence of asbestos in building materials during property assessments.
Pre-Remodel Testing - Checks for asbestos before renovation or demolition projects to ensure safety.
Asbestos Sampling - Collects samples from suspected materials for laboratory analysis.
Asbestos Management Plans - Develops strategies for safe handling and removal of asbestos-containing materials.
Asbestos Clearance Testing - Verifies that asbestos removal has been completed safely and thoroughly.
Asbestos Consultation - Provides guidance on asbestos risks and appropriate mitigation steps.
Asbestos Assessment Questions
What is an asbestos assessment? It is a process to identify the presence of asbestos-containing materials in a property, often before renovation or demolition projects.
When is an asbestos assessment needed? An assessment is recommended when inspecting older buildings or if asbestos-containing materials are suspected during renovations or repairs.
What types of properties typically require asbestos assessments? Residential homes, commercial buildings, and public facilities built before the 1980s often need assessments for asbestos presence.
